Stephen Stills and Kenny Wayne Shepherd are teaming up with keyboardist Barry Goldberg for a new trio dubbed the Rides, and will release a new album entitled Can't Get Enough on July 30.
In addition to eight original tracks, inspired by a 1968 collaboration with Electric Flag's Mike Bloomfield and Blood, Sweat & Tears' keyboard player Al Kooper, Can't Get Enough features a pair of covers, Iggy and the Stooges' "Search and Destroy" and Neil Young's "Rockin' the Free World."
